A global bank is seeking a Head of Network Sector Coverage in London. This role involves managing a diverse team and executing sector strategies, contributing to commercial success while promoting an inclusive culture.
Ideal candidates will have deep experience in banking, strong analytical and leadership skills, and the ability to work in multi-cultural environments. If you're results-driven and align with core banking values, this position offers a strategic leadership opportunity.

How to prepare for a job interview at ING
β¨Know Your Sector Inside Out
Make sure youβre well-versed in the latest trends and challenges within the banking sector. Research the bank's current strategies and how they align with market demands. This will show your potential employer that youβre not just familiar with the industry, but also passionate about driving growth.
β¨Showcase Your Leadership Style
Prepare to discuss your leadership experiences and how you've successfully managed diverse teams in the past. Use specific examples that highlight your ability to foster an inclusive culture while achieving results. This will demonstrate that you can lead effectively in a multi-cultural environment.
β¨Be Results-Driven
Come equipped with quantifiable achievements from your previous roles. Whether itβs revenue growth, successful project completions, or team performance improvements, having concrete examples will illustrate your results-driven mindset and align with the bank's core values.
β¨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ions that reflect your understanding of the role and the bank's strategic goals. Inquire about their approach to sector coverage and how they measure success. This not only shows your interest but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
